Finding a molecular mass

Step-by-step explanation

1. Break down the molecule to its elements

The molecule C17H20N4O6 consists of:
17 Carbon atoms
20 Hydrogen atoms
4 Nitrogen atoms
6 Oxygen atoms

2. Identify the atomic mass of each element

The atomic mass is shown below each element on the periodic table.

C17H20N4O6 molecules consist of:
Carbon C=12.0107 u
Hydrogen H=1.00794 u
Nitrogen N=14.0067 u
Oxygen O=15.9994 u

3. Calculate the total atomic mass of each element in a molecule of C17H20N4O6

C17 → 17·12.0107=204.18189999999998 u
H20 → 20·1.00794=20.1588 u
N4 → 4·14.0067=56.0268 u
O6 → 6·15.9994=95.9964 u

4. Calculate the mass of the molecule C17H20N4O6

204.18189999999998+20.1588+56.0268+95.9964=376.36389999999994

The average molecular mass of C17H20N4O6 is 376.36389999999994 u.
